intoxicative

American  
[in-tok-si-key-tiv] / ɪnˈtɒk sɪˌkeɪ tɪv /

adjective

Archaic.
  1. of or relating to intoxicants or intoxication.

  2. intoxicating.


Other Word Forms

Derived Forms

Etymology

Origin of intoxicative

First recorded in 1625–35; intoxicate + -ive
